Data parsing errors, in my experience, naturally result from a programs inability to read the data, or a general problem with the data itself. Battle tested in production, parsing and formatting millions of records every day. The user inputs which column to search by the user inputs a search term the programme searches the list to find a match the programme then. I received a number of requests about how to apply this to reading comma delimited or positional data files. The file has no consistent structure so you will have to experiment. If you downloaded the file causing the parse error, try downloading the file again or look for an updated version of the file. It has rows of tab delimited data under four columns. You will have write a relatively advanced script to parse the file. For example, a field containing name of the city will not parse as an integer.
More often than not, using a previousnewer version of acrobat has resolved the issue if its a programspecific issue. It can parse many delimited file formats such as csv, tab delimited, and pipe delimited. So, i was wondering if anyone else uses this type of file for transport purposes. The data generator processor and destinations that write delimited data include a new quote mode property on the data format tab when you select a custom delimiter format for delimited data. So todays your lucky day, and by the end of this tutorial, youll be able an excel and csv parsing professional. Data parse is a programmable parsing tool that can extract, manipulate, convert or mine existing data sources and turn them into importable data. Is it possible to load data from tabdelimited text files, not just from excell or access. The article contains comparison and main features of the data loading tools provided by teradata. It has rows of tabdelimited data under four columns. If the data is pipe delimited, then you do not need to provide a delimiter character, as that is the default.
Have you tried other 3d pdf viewers, or acrobat on another machine as a sanity check. Five applications for parsing big data techrepublic. Built with streams first to avoid creating large memory footprint when parsing large files. Hopefully you wont run into any of them, but if you do weve got you covered. Right now i dont have the admin rights to change the program in arduino so that data parsing could be easier. Thats because the writetoserver method only accepts datatables or datareaders as data sources. Text file parsing software free download text file. Importing delimited device files into a mysql database using a mysql load data script. Highperformance techniques for importing csv to sql. On a 100mb file i was seeing memory sizes over 500mb.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. Parsing software free download parsing top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ices.
Hi, one user here wants to use sql developer to load data into oracle, but cant use excel as a source because her data files are larger than what excel can handle. Were using a third party app which has modified this standard object. Ive encountered a thousand different problems with data importing and flat files over the last 20 years. If you want to specify it anyway, you need to use the delimiter attribute and set it to. The user inputs which column to search by the user inputs a search term the programme searches the list to find a match the programme then prints the whole row containing the matching data. And i will show you how to parse a spaceseparated text file into a python dict that we can use later. From data collector, you now download the support bundle to your machine. Ive distilled this list down to the most common issues among all the databases ive worked with. Teradata parallel transporter supports quoted vartext in. This means that you can run the sqlloader client on a different system from the one. How to handle the exception with the invalid csv file like double quotes in the content.
In this column, well get more in depth with reading from files and examine the task of parsing data from a file. In order to be able to download the files on ie8 you need to change your configuration settings. Tab delimited csv file generates found unescaped quote. Guess i read the subject extracting data to a flat file. Parsing software free download parsing top 4 download. Load data faster from flat file to oracle table oracle. A database table to which the data from the file will be imported. Fastcsv is library for parsing and formatting csvs or any other delimited value file in node. We are basically parsing this type of data using an unstring. Sqlloader step by step guide how to load a datafile. Sql loader allows you to load data from an external file into a table in the database. Accessgudid importing delimited device files into a.
This tutorial shows you how to use the load data infile statement to import csv file into mysql table the load data infile statement allows you to read data from a text file and import the files data into a database table very fast before importing the file, you need to prepare the following. It was also taking over 15 minutes to process the file. Xmltype data can be present in a control file or in a lob file. Text file parsing software free download text file parsing top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. In this case, the lob file name is present in the control file. The library has a set of converters for the basic types and can be easily extended to provide custom converters.
Direct path load with sql loader if you cannot use parallelism is pretty fast you can also use direct path insert with external tables. In part 4 of our csv series, ill give you my magic fixes. My flat file is report format, can i load data using import or fast load. I have looked in the help section and tried formating it to 20412 12420 1204 0412 no joy i have read the threads on here and the link to this document no joy. Home powershell highperformance techniques for importing csv to sql server using powershell.
The consequences depend on the mode that the parser runs in. A delimiter is a character that separates words or phrases in a text string that defines the. How to parse excel and csv files using php ccb tutorials. When reading csv files with a specified schema, it is possible that the actual data in the files does not match the specified schema. Im trying to run data loader from the command line and export all the fields for the contact object. Command is not completed and session is hanging for some time after. I suspect it is unix delimited lines so you might start by splitting it on the unix line terminator.
Flexible formatting and parsing options, to fit almost any scenario. The arduino is receiving data via sms, and my goal is to parse and save the data using processing and make a data visualization realtime, at the same time. Teradata data loading tools multiload, fastload and tpump. Problem description i have my data arranged in a tab delimited file and im trying to parseaccess certain parts of it. If your data contains the pipe character, then you must enclose the field in. As an example, id like to extract the number of points and the sampling. You explanation is focused to import data to sql and that is not my concern. If possible, try downloading the file from a different site. Please find an example of the data file, and the cod. Hi chan, there are some known issues with special characters, so we would advise to avoid them when using dataloader. Sqlloader loads data from external files into tables of an oracle database.
The tutorial illustrates main features of teradata multiload, fastload and tpump parallel data pump and provides sample reallife uses of those tools. In computer programming, a delimited text file is a file in which the individual data values contain embedded delimiters, such as quotation marks, commas, and tabs. When migrating to church community builder ccb, sometimes other church management software providers give you a backup of your data in an excel or xml file. Well start by loading data about the weather stations. I recently received a tutorial request about creating a tutorial using php to parse excel and csv files. For example sales department sends daily sale data in excel sheet to it department, how this data feed into oracle database to tables. It seems that theres yes value instead of date value also be sure that your date format is accaptable for salesforce. I will show you how to download a file over ftp, using python. Because xmltype data can be quite large, sqlloader can load lob data from either a primary datafile in line with the rest of the data or from lob files independent of how the data is stored. But you need to have an additional step of parsing it to your datatypes since regexserde accepts string by default. Using oledbconnection is a powerful, fast way to import entire csvs or subsets of csv data.
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. We found some errors while parsing your source file. Memsql fast loader destination inserts data into a memsql or mysql. It has a powerful data parsing engine that puts little limitation on the format of the data in the datafile.
Delimited by we are creating it using a string verb. Python 2 parse tabdelimited text file data into a list. Instead of rekeying it, reformat it with data parse free edition a flexible, programmable data file converter. Use the most appropriate existing exception type, or make one if none fits the bill appropriately. Lets navigate to the location in the filesystem where you can find our exercise files. I want to keep double quotes finally or catching the exception and ignoring the invalid row is acceptable as well, like the following example, i wan. All the work that we do in this chapter will flow from one video to the next, so i. The filehelpers are an easy to use library to importexport data from fixed length or delimited flat files like the csv. Ive defined a mapping file containing all the fields that are exported when you use the data loader tool itself. I need to parse a tab delimited text file by grabbing specific columns, like columns 1 and 5, and output each of these columns into a text file. As others have suggested, if its applicable the records in your file need to be fixedlength as opposed to delimited, you can use parallelism with external tables. Browse other questions tagged data streams parsing or ask your own question.